A new RAND study finds that many community college students drop out very early—after they register for classes but before enrollment is finalized.

This early attrition isn't related to motivation or academics. Rather, students are frustrated by administrative obstacles.
The Students Who Disappear Before They Count
Community colleges are slowly rebounding from the pandemic, but many students disappear between applying and the first weeks of class. These early losses often stem from institutional hurdles, not aca...
